There’s Still Time: “Design + Industry” Exhibition Open to the Public in Brasília Until July 20, 2025

If you’re in Brasília or planning to visit the Brazilian capital in the coming weeks, you still have the chance to experience the special “Design + Industry” exhibition at the National Museum of the Republic. The show has been extended and will remain open to the public until July 20, 2025, with free admission, as part of the official program of the Brasília Design Week (BDW) 2025.

It’s a unique opportunity to explore, in one of the city’s most iconic cultural spaces, the results of collaborative work between designers and manufacturers from different regions of Brazil. The featured pieces were developed with the support of the Brazilian Furniture Project, an initiative led by ABIMÓVEL (Brazilian Furniture Manufacturers Association) in partnership with ApexBrasil (Brazilian Trade and Investment Promotion Agency), which promotes the internationalization and competitive growth of the Brazilian furniture industry.

Design as a Contemporary Expression

After being showcased at Milan Design Week and New York Design Week, “Design + Industry” arrives in Brasília with a selection of creations that merge innovation, sustainability, and Brazilian identity. More than just a furniture exhibition, the show highlights major global design trends, such as the use of renewable materials, hybrid and multifunctional solutions, a focus on original and locally inspired design, and a strong social and environmental commitment. By doing so, the exhibition invites visitors to reflect on how we produce, consume, and interact with objects in our daily lives.

According to Cândida Cervieri, Executive Director of ABIMÓVEL, “When strategically applied within the industry, design drives process transformation, fosters smart solutions, and elevates the international profile of Brazilian manufacturing — reinforcing the country’s image as a source of innovation and quality in the global market.”

An Experience in the Heart of Brasília

Housed at the National Museum of the Republic, right on Brasília’s Monumental Axis, the exhibition is part of the Brasília Design Week 2025, a city-wide event that turns the capital into a vibrant stage for design, featuring exhibitions, talks, workshops, parallel shows, and urban interventions.

With the theme “Design, Memory, and Future”, this year’s BDW sparks a dialogue between Brasília’s cultural legacy — as a UNESCO Creative City of Design — and contemporary perspectives that connect creativity, innovation, and sustainable development.

Brazilian Furniture Project

The Brazilian Furniture Project is a sectoral initiative by ABIMÓVEL in partnership with ApexBrasil. Its goal is to expand the international presence of Brazil’s furniture industry through a strategic set of actions grounded in sustainability, competitiveness, and design integration. Currently, around 175 companies are engaged in the project.

In 2024, Brazil ranked as the sixth-largest furniture and mattress producer in the world and the 26th largest exporter, generating over US$ 763.02 million in revenue from finished products — a 3.8% increase compared to 2023. Including parts for furniture manufacturing, the total reached US$ 870.20 million.

About ABIMÓVEL

The Brazilian Furniture Manufacturers Association (ABIMÓVEL) has represented the national furniture industry for nearly five decades. Acting from north to south, the organization works to strengthen the sector through a forward-looking agenda in partnership with public and private stakeholders. Its initiatives aim to boost production, improve the business environment, and expand access to international markets. These efforts include international trade shows, business matchmaking events, export programs, sustainability actions, integrated design projects, factory modernization, support for small businesses, and commercial intelligence programs. 

 

About ApexBrasil

The Brazilian Trade and Investment Promotion Agency (ApexBrasil) works to promote Brazilian products and services abroad and attract foreign investments to strategic sectors of the Brazilian economy. In order to achieve its goals, ApexBrasil carries out several trade promotion initiatives aimed at promoting Brazilian products and services abroad, such as prospective and trade missions, business rounds, support to the participation of Brazilian companies in major international fairs, visits of foreign buyers and opinion makers to learn about the Brazilian productive structure, among other business platforms that also aim at strengthening the Brazil brand. The Agency also acts in a coordinated way with public and private players to attract foreign direct investment (FDI) to Brazil, with a focus on strategic sectors for the development of the competitiveness of Brazilian companies and the country.
